Haridwar, nestled in the northern Indian state of Uttarakhand, is a city of immense spiritual and cultural significance. Known as one of the seven holiest places (Sapta Puri) in Hinduism, Haridwar translates to "Gateway to God." This ancient city, located on the banks of the sacred River Ganges, is a beacon for millions of pilgrims who seek spiritual solace and enlightenment.

Historical and Religious Significance

Haridwar's history is intricately tied to Hindu mythology and tradition. It is believed to be the place where drops of the elixir of immortality, Amrit, accidentally spilled over from the Kumbh Mela pitcher carried by the celestial bird Garuda. This mythological event is commemorated every twelve years during the grand Kumbh Mela, one of the largest religious gatherings in the world. The city's sacred ghats, particularly Har Ki Pauri, are thronged by devotees year-round for ritualistic bathing, believed to cleanse sins and grant salvation.

1. Har Ki Pauri

Har Ki Pauri is the most iconic landmark in Haridwar. This revered ghat, meaning "Steps of Lord Shiva," is renowned for the evening Ganga Aarti, a mesmerizing ritual where priests perform prayers with lit lamps, accompanied by the chanting of hymns. The sight of thousands of floating diyas on the Ganges creates a breathtaking spectacle, attracting pilgrims and tourists alike.

2. Chandi Devi Temple

Perched atop the Neel Parvat on the eastern bank of the River Ganges, Chandi Devi Temple is dedicated to Goddess Chandi. Visitors can reach the temple via a scenic cable car ride, offering panoramic views of Haridwar. The temple, built in 1929 by the then King of Kashmir, Suchat Singh, is a significant pilgrimage site, especially during the Navratri festival.

3. Mansa Devi Temple

Located on the Bilwa Parvat, the Mansa Devi Temple is another prominent hilltop shrine. Dedicated to Goddess Mansa Devi, it is believed that the goddess fulfills the wishes of her devotees. The temple can be accessed either by a trekking path or a cable car, providing a serene and spiritual experience.

4. Rajaji National Park

For nature enthusiasts, Rajaji National Park is a must-visit. Spread over an area of 820 square kilometers, the park is home to a rich variety of flora and fauna, including elephants, tigers, leopards, and over 400 bird species. Wildlife safaris and bird watching are popular activities here, making it a perfect spot for adventure and nature lovers.

5. Maya Devi Temple

Maya Devi Temple is one of the oldest temples in Haridwar, dating back to the 11th century. It is dedicated to Goddess Maya, an incarnation of Shakti. The temple holds great historical and mythological significance, being one of the three Siddh Peethas in Haridwar, where it is believed that the heart and navel of Goddess Sati fell.

6. Bharat Mata Mandir

Unlike other temples in Haridwar, Bharat Mata Mandir is dedicated to Mother India. This unique temple, with its eight floors, is a tribute to Indian culture, history, and heroes. Each floor is adorned with sculptures, paintings, and statues representing different deities, historical figures, and freedom fighters, making it a place of national pride and reverence.

7. Shanti Kunj

Shanti Kunj, the headquarters of the All World Gayatri Pariwar, is a spiritual and social organization founded by Pandit Shriram Sharma Acharya. It offers various spiritual training programs, yoga sessions, and meditation camps, attracting people seeking spiritual growth and holistic wellness.
